Man Arrested After High-Speed Chase through Adamstown, Hamilton South, and Merewether

newy.com.au – A 21-year-old man has been charged after a police pursuit through Newcastle suburbs in the early hours of Friday, 14 March 2025, led to the discovery of an alleged unauthorised firearm in his possession.

The incident began around 12.50am when officers from Newcastle City Police District spotted a moped carrying a pillion passenger travelling dangerously along Brunker Road, Adamstown. When police attempted to stop the vehicle, the rider failed to comply, triggering a pursuit.

The chase moved through the suburbs of Adamstown, Hamilton South, and Merewether before coming to an end on Henry Street, Merewether, where the vehicle stopped, and both riders fled on foot. Officers quickly apprehended the alleged rider following a short foot pursuit, while the passenger managed to escape and remains at large.

Upon searching the 21-year-old, police allegedly discovered an unauthorised firearm. He was taken into custody and transported to Newcastle Police Station, where he was charged with multiple offences, including unlawful entry, possession of an unauthorised firearm, failing to stop during a police pursuit, and possessing suspected stolen goods. Additionally, he was charged with offences related to vehicle licensing.

The accused was refused bail and is set to appear before Newcastle Local Court on Friday, 14 March 2025. Investigations are ongoing as police continue efforts to locate the second individual involved.
